Fuka Nagano moves to Liverpool from the US side, North Carolina Courage.
The 23-year-old played in South Korea and Japan before joining North Carolina last July. The Japanese midfielder, who has 34 caps for the national team, played 11 matches in the National Women’s Soccer League and scored two goals. She become second winter arrival for the Reds, which also signed Sofie Lundgaaard.
“I’m very happy to join such a great team and club. I’m really pleased to play for a club that has a great history. As part of the team, I’m ready to give my everything and willing to work as hard as I can,” said Nagano.
